The long-term problems linked to dropping out of school are correctly suggested by which of the following statements?A.About 90 percent of people who use illegal drugs are school dropouts.B.Half of all fatal auto accidents involve a driver who dropped out of school.C.About 70 percent of the U.S. prison population is people who have dropped out of school.D.Almost all victims of sexual abuse are high school dropouts.

Solution

The question is asking for the long-term problems linked to dropping out of school.

Option A suggests a link between drug use and dropping out of school. However, it does not necessarily imply a long-term problem directly related to dropping out of school, as drug use can be influenced by many other factors.

Option B suggests a link between fatal auto accidents and school dropouts. However, this is more of a correlation rather than a direct consequence of dropping out of school.

Option D suggests a link between being a victim of sexual abuse and being a high school dropout. However, being a victim of sexual abuse is not a consequence of dropping out of school.

Option C, on the other hand, suggests that about 70 percent of the U.S. prison population is people who have dropped out of school. This implies a direct long-term problem linked to dropping out of school, as it suggests that people who drop out of school are more likely to end up in prison.

Therefore, the correct answer is C. About 70 percent of the U.S. prison population is people who have dropped out of school.
